Toronto Blue Jays enter game two of the season-opening series with a 1-0 lead after Andrés Giménez's walk-off RBI single secured a 3-2 victory over the Oakland Athletics yesterday at Rogers Centre, boosting home momentum. Probable starters Jeffrey Springs (LHP) for Oakland and Dylan Cease (RHP) for Toronto set up a pivotal pitching matchup, with Cease's strikeout ability and the Jays' 54-27 home record last season shaping trader consensus. Athletics scratch RF Lawrence Butler from the lineup, impacting outfield depth, while Toronto manages without injured pitchers Shane Bieber (elbow, out until May), Jose Berrios, Yimi Garcia, and OF Anthony Santander on the 10-day IL. Hot early bats like Shea Langeliers (2 HR game one) and Vladimir Guerrero Jr. (.333 AVG) loom large in this AL clash.
